Types of motorcycle jacks

There are several types of motorcycle jacks available on the market, each designed for specific purposes and types of motorcycles. The most common types of motorcycle jacks include:

1. Scissor Jacks: Scissor jacks are the most basic type of motorcycle jack and are commonly used for lifting motorcycles with a center stand. They are compact, lightweight, and easy to use. However, scissor jacks have weight limitations and may not be suitable for heavier bikes.

2. Hydraulic Jacks: Hydraulic jacks are more advanced and offer higher weight capacity compared to scissor jacks. They use hydraulic pressure to lift the motorcycle efficiently and securely. Hydraulic jacks are ideal for heavier bikes and more extensive repair tasks.

3. Wheel Chock Stands: Wheel chock stands are specifically designed to stabilize the front wheel of the motorcycle while it is elevated. They provide extra support and prevent the bike from tipping over during maintenance tasks. Wheel chock stands are often used in conjunction with other types of motorcycle jacks for added safety.

4. Lift Tables: Lift tables are heavy-duty motorcycle jacks that offer a flat platform for lifting the entire bike. They are commonly used in professional garages and workshops for performing detailed maintenance and repairs. Lift tables provide excellent stability and accessibility to all parts of the motorcycle.

Features to Consider

When choosing a motorcycle jack, there are several features to consider to ensure you get the most suitable one for your needs. Some essential features to look for include:

1. Weight Capacity: Make sure to choose a motorcycle jack that can safely support the weight of your motorcycle. Check the weight capacity of the jack and compare it to the weight of your bike before making a purchase.

2. Stability: Look for a motorcycle jack that is stable and sturdy to prevent accidents and injuries while working on your bike. Choose a jack with wide base legs, anti-slip rubber pads, and secure locking mechanisms for added stability.

3. Height Adjustment: Consider a motorcycle jack with height adjustment features to accommodate different types of motorcycles and maintenance tasks. Adjustable height allows you to lift the bike to a comfortable working height and makes it easier to access hard-to-reach areas.

4. Portability: If you need to transport your motorcycle jack to different locations, consider the portability of the jack. Look for a lightweight and compact design that is easy to carry and store when not in use.

Choosing the Right Motorcycle Jack

When selecting a motorcycle jack, it is essential to consider your specific needs and the type of maintenance tasks you will be performing. If you have a lightweight bike and only need to perform basic maintenance, a scissor jack may be sufficient. However, if you have a heavy or custom bike and require more extensive repairs, a hydraulic jack or lift table may be more suitable.

It is also important to consider your budget when choosing a motorcycle jack. While more advanced jacks may offer additional features and higher weight capacity, they can also be more expensive. Make sure to research different brands and models to find a motorcycle jack that offers the best value for your money.
